The table below lists every degree level available for drama & theater arts at AADA, along with how many graduates complete each level annually.
| Degree Level | Annual Graduates |
|---|---|
| Associate’s | 85 |
During the most recent reporting year, American Academy of Dramatic Arts-Los Angeles awarded 85 associate’s degrees in drama & theater arts.

For the most recent academic year available, 40% of drama & theater arts associate’s degrees went to men and 60% went to women.
The majority of drama & theater arts associate’s degree graduates at AADA were Non-Resident Alien. Approximately 31%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from American Academy of Dramatic Arts-Los Angeles with a associate’s in drama & theater arts.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 4 |
| Black or African American | 11 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 14 |
| White | 25 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 26 |
| Other Races | 5 |
